An Act relative to inhalant abuse by minors.
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ives in General Court assembled, and by the authority of the same, as
follows:
SECTION 1.
Section
35 of Chapter 123 of the General Laws is hereby amended by inserting the words ‘or
substance
s
having property of releasing toxic vapors
’ after the phrase “a person who chronically or habitually consumes or ingests controlled
substances”
in the definition of “substance abuser”.
SECTION 2. For purposes of this Act, the definition of “
substance
s
having property of releasing toxic vapors
” will be that described in Section 18 of Chapter 270 of the General Laws.
